We're looking for information (name of teacher, year experiment conducted, name of video describing experiment) for an experiment conducted by a teacher to demonstrate how prejudice is learned. As we remember it, she divided her class into "blue-eyed" and "brown-eyed" groups and then discriminated against one group. We think it happened in the late 50s or early 60s.
